Data distribution through capacity leveling in a striped file system

RP Jernigan IV - US Patent 8,117,388, 2012 - Google Patents
5. 63, 31 A 1 1/1992 Row et al. manner so that they are optimally assigned to the nodes in
5,202,979 A 4, 1993 Hillis et al. accordance with each node's capacity value. By utilizing the …

Method and system for rebuilding data in a distributed RAID system

WC Galloway, RA Callison… - US Patent 8,082,393, 2011 - Google Patents
(US); Ryan A. Callison, Magnolia, TX 2003. O135709 A1 7, 2003 Niles et al.(US); George J.
Scholhamer, III, 2003/0159001 A1 8/2003 Chalmer et al. Tomball, TX (US) 2004.0003173 …

Map-reduce ready distributed file system

MC Srivas, P Ravindra, UV Saradhi, AA Pande… - US Patent …, 2016 - Google Patents
A map-reduce compatible distributed file system that consists of successive component
layers that each provide the basis on which the next layer is built provides transactional read …

Optimizing data transmission bandwidth consumption over a wide area network

MC Constantinescu, JS Glider - US Patent 8,468,135, 2013 - Google Patents
BACKGROUND Data is typically stored on computing systems and/or attached storage
devices. The data may include operating system data, file system data, and application data …

System and method for redundancy-protected aggregates

RP Jernigan IV, RW Hyer Jr, ML Kazar… - US Patent …, 2013 - Google Patents
AGGREGAEB AGGREGAEC fails, new data may still be accessed by the system (the striped
aggregates), both to write new data, and to read data stored on the failed aggregate. In …

Map-reduce ready distributed file system

MC Srivas, P Ravindra, UV Saradhi, AA Pande… - US Patent …, 2015 - Google Patents
A map-reduce compatible distributed file system that consists of successive component
layers that each provide the basis on which the next layer is built provides transactional read …

Low latency RDMA-based distributed storage

A Shamis, Y Suzue, KM Risvik - US Patent 10,375,167, 2019 - Google Patents
Abstract A “Distributed Storage Controller” applies an RDMA-based memory allocator to
implement a distributed thread-safe and lock-free storage system in shared memory …

Distributed lock-free RDMA-based memory allocation and de-allocation

Y Suzue, A Shamis, KM Risvik - US Patent 10,725,963, 2020 - Google Patents
Abstract An “RDMA-Based Memory Allocator” applies remote direct memory access (RDMA)
messaging to provide fast lock-free memory allocations and de-allocations for shared …

Hybrid hash tables

PD Beaman, RS Newson, TM Tran - US Patent 8,397,051, 2013 - Google Patents
A hash table system having a first hash table and a second hash table is provided. The first
hash table may be in-memory and the second hash table may be on-disk. Inserting an entry …

Distributed storage medium management for heterogeneous storage media in high availability clusters

MW Dalton - US Patent 9,063,939, 2015 - Google Patents
G06F 5/73(2006.01)(57) ABSTRACT G06F 7/30(2006.01) A high availability cluster and
method of storage medium GO6F 9/50(2006.01) management in Such high availability …